Using SteamDB Playercounts to Estimate Actual Playerbase Size and What That Potentially Means for Bungie's Bottom Line and the Longevity of Marathon
No AI was used in the preparation or writing of this post.
So there is a lot of discussion about playercounts in the comments here, and discussions elsewhere about this game and these discussions almost never put the playercounts we see on SteamDB into their proper context.
As the rest of this post will attempt to illustrate, even with our current (fairly disheartening) playercounts, there is likely still enough ongoing revenue coming in to support the operating costs of a fairly large (by industry standards, not necessarily by Bungie standards) development team.
This is not a short post, but it is not as long as it first appears due to the use of a code block and a table. I've also put some of the less important bits behind spoilers to make skimming past them easier. The majority of this post's content is just providing the calculations and estimation methodology. If you don't care about any of that you can skip to the 'Conclusion' section at the bottom.

Monthly Operating Cost Estimate
Assume a nominal salary of $115,000 for Bungie employees, then multiply by 1.6 to estimate^(1) nominal salary + employer costs (healthcare, retirement, FICA, etc.) for a yearly cost per employee of $184,000. Then divide that by 12 for the monthly cost per employee (commonly referred to as 'burn rate') which works out to $15,333. Then multiply that by the team size (commonly assumed to be ~400 though no one actually knows), for a monthly team cost of ~$6.1 million. Working from the base $184,000 per employee cost for the year a team of 400 would cost $73.6 million per year.
>!Now this excludes things like office space rent, computer equipment, software licensing, etc., however these are going to be a small minority of the studio's total costs relative to the labor expenses (costs of employees). This math is also assuming every single employee is a developer being paid at that salary rate when in reality that won't be the case with some of the employees being in relatively low paid positions like secretaries, or other less well paid positions than that of a software developer, as well as some employees being in more highly paid positions like directors and other forms of leadership, we can ignore that in this case and just assume that the average of those other positions more or less nets out.!<

Per Player Spend & Monthly Revenue
The exact portion of players that buy microtransactions varies quite a bit from game to game so we'll instead work with 'average per player monthly spend.' While hard figures on this are virtually completely unavailable there are a lot of grounded estimates out there. I'm going to assume an average monthly per player spend of $7 including battlepasses and skins^(2) but ignoring up front price of the game, factoring in the platform cut of 30% that works out to about $5 of actual realized revenue per player on average (most players spend nothing, some players spend something, a few players spend A LOT).
In order to estimate monthly revenue using this figure we need an estimate for the playerbase size against which to multiply the estimated average monthly per player spend. Now it is important to note this is Monthly Active Players (MAU) not Peak Concurrent Players (SteamDB counts), Daily Active Players, or even Weekly Active Players.

Extrapolating DAU, WAU, and MAU
I'll be using the below calculations to estimate the specific values. The resulting estimates are highly sensitive to the provided input (given) values. I encourage you to mock up these calculations on a spreadsheet yourself and adjust the inputs to see just how sensitive, especially since most of these inputs require me to make reasonable assumptions about their true values.
_Given Values_
[Daily Average CCU] = ?
[Average Hours Played per Day] = ? per Player
[Average Days Played per Week] = ? per Player
[Average Weeks Played per Month] = ? per Player
[Percent of Active Users on Consoles] = ? as a decimal value; 70% = 0.7
[Average Monthly Realized Revenue per Player] = ?
---
[Total Hours Played per Day] = [Daily Average CCU] * 24
_PC Estimates_
PC_DAU = [Total Hours Played] / [Average Hours Played per Day]
PC_WAU = (DAU * 7) / [Average Days Played per Week]
PC_MAU = (WAU * 4) / [Average Weeks Played per Month]
_Total Estimates_
DAU = PC_DAU / (1 - [Percent of Active Users on Consoles])
WAU = PC_WAU / (1 - [Percent of Active Users on Consoles])
MAU = PC_MAU / (1 - [Percent of Active Users on Consoles])
_Revenue Estimate_
Monthly Revenue = MAU * [Average Monthly Realized Revenue per Player]
Using the only hard data we have of ~4,000 per day (eyeballing the chart for the past week) for [Daily Average CCU], and the above established estimate of $5 for [Average Monthly Realized Revenue per Player] and using several sets of what I believe to be reasonable assumptions for the other inputs we arrive at the below.

Sets 1-3 vary only the number of days played per week. Set 4 is my own guess for what the actual given values look like, and Set 5 is a hypothethical case identical to Set 4 but adjusting [Daily Average CCU] to reflect the minimum value necessary for revenue to exceed the estimated monthly cost of $6.1 million.
Conclusion
Based on this analysis it would appear that a sustained 4x - 5x increase is needed to cover the ongoing costs associated with the game. The last time we were in that range was approximatley the week of Sunday 4/12 - Saturday 4/18.
The current playerbase is only sufficient to support a development team size of ~100. While this is only a fraction of the current (presumed) team size, it is still a very significant number of developers, and at most studios, more than enough to support, or indeed even develop a game of Marathon's scope and size. ID for example stated recently that they developed Doom 2016 with a team size of about 50 people, though I'm sure some amount of outsourcing was used as well which has its own costs.
